This hiking route in the Prealpes-de-Haute-Provence area is extremely difficult, covering a distance of 10.848 kilometers with an elevation gain of 1208 meters. The duration of the hike is estimated to be around 5 hours and 31 minutes, so it is essential to be well-prepared before embarking on this challenging adventure.
Starting at La Mournière, hikers will come across several points of interest along the way. At the beginning of the trail, you will find the Cabane des Mulets, a shelter located 1.26 kilometers from the starting point. This non-guarded cabin provides a resting spot for hikers to take a break and enjoy the scenic surroundings.
As you make your way further along the trail, approximately 5.42 kilometers from the start, you will reach La Mournière, a peak offering bre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. This is a great spot to capture some memorable photos and appreciate the natural beauty of the area.
Midway through the hike, at 4.44 kilometers from the start, you will encounter Col La Pierre, a saddle that offers a unique vantage point for taking in the panoramic views. This is a perfect place to stop and admire the stunning scenery before continuing on your journey.
